コード例 #1
0
        public void BrokedRoom(BrokedRoomDTO room)
        {
            try
            {
                string          connectionString = ConfigurationManager.ConnectionStrings["ConnectToSQL"].ConnectionString;
                IRoomRepository repository       = new RoomRepository(connectionString);

                NewRoom newRoom = new NewRoom();
                newRoom.Fio               = room.Fio;
                newRoom.NumberPhone       = room.NumberPhone;
                newRoom.Email             = room.Email;
                newRoom.DescriptionRommId = room.DescriptionRommId;
                newRoom.DateFrom          = room.DateFrom;
                newRoom.DateTo            = room.DateTo;
                newRoom.Reserve           = room.Reserve;

                repository.BrokedRoom(newRoom);
            }
            catch (Exception e)
            {
                Exception baseException = e.GetBaseException();
                throw new FaultException(e.Message);
            }
        }